Ritwik Ghatak’s long-lost poem discovered!

It came as a huge surprise when a film archivist looking for movie posters at a scrap shop suddenly came across a treasure trove of extremely rare photographs of music legend Ravi Shankar along with some musical notes penned by the late sitarist.

SMM Ausaja

, the film archivist recently received a call from a scrap dealer in Mahim, Mumbai and he handed him a suitcase which belonged to a musician.

In the suitcase, Ausaja also discovered a poem written by the revolutionary filmmaker Ritwik Ghatak. “The most sensational discovery was Ritwik Ghatak’s handwritten poetry with his signature. He may have had written it for Pandit Ravi Shankar, that is why it was found in the box probably. It is priceless and nobody knows about it,” Ausaja said.

“When I opened the suitcase (at home) and started going through the documents, I realised how big a part they were of our cultural heritage,” Ausaja added.

Ausaja has written two books on cinema, ‘Bollywood in Posters’ and ‘Bollywood: The Films! The Songs! The Stars!’ and treasures a huge collection of rare

Bollywood

posters.
